1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is repetition in poetry?
Back
Repetition in poetry is when words or phrases are repeated to create rhythm, emphasize a point, or make the poem more memorable.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Why do poets use repetition?
Back
Poets use repetition to highlight important ideas, create a musical quality, and engage the reader's attention.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Give an example of repetition in a poem.
Back
An example of repetition is the phrase 'I have a dream' in Martin Luther King Jr.'s famous speech.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does it mean if a phrase is repeated in a story?
Back
If a phrase is repeated in a story, it usually emphasizes a key idea or theme that the author wants the reader to remember.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Identify a repeated phrase in the poem 'Twinkle, Twinkle, Little Star'.
Back
The phrase 'Twinkle, twinkle' is repeated throughout the poem.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
True or False: Repetition can make a poem more fun to read.
Back
True. Repetition can create a rhythm that makes poems enjoyable.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is an example of repetition in a song?
Back
In the song 'Row, Row, Row Your Boat', the word 'row' is repeated.
